I have had fybromayalga for four years now.
I recently been experiencing different pain related to fybromayalga.
I have started to get a stabbing sharp pain at the back of my throat also in my chest.
I have had it check out with my GP by checking my Hart which she reassure me it was fine..
She came to the conclusion that it was my fybromayalga.
As anybody experienced this pain?

Members confirmed that sharp stabbing pains in the throat and chest are experiences they share with fibromyalgia, with many describing how frightening these symptoms can be until doctors ruled out heart problems and confirmed the pain as fibromyalgia-related. Several members found relief through medications like amitriptyline, nitroglycerin, baclofen, and cyclobenzaprine, while others mentioned the importance of ruling out other conditions such as chest wall syndrome, GERD, or hiatal hernia through proper testing. A recurring theme was the validation of having a community where members can ask about new symptoms without fear of judgment, as fibromyalgia often presents unpredictable pain that can make people feel like they're going mad or that it's all in their head.
